Smoking asthma phenotype: diagnostic and management challenges
Petros Bakakos1, Konstantinos Kostikas, Stelios Loukides
11st University Department of Respiratory Medicine, University of Athens, Athens, Greece.
Smoking in adults with asthma worsens disease control and lung function. Effective treatments are needed as current guidelines lack specific advice for these patients.

Background:
- Prevalence of active smoking in adults with asthma mirrors the general population.
- Smoking in asthmatic patients is linked to poorer disease control, reduced corticosteroid effectiveness, faster lung function decline, and higher healthcare use.
- Asthma guidelines lack specific management strategies for smoking asthmatic individuals.

Main Results:
- Strong evidence links active and passive smoking to adult-onset asthma.
- Asthma-COPD Overlap Syndrome (ACOS) is a key consideration for smoking asthmatics.
- Recommended treatments include higher-dose inhaled corticosteroids (ICS), extrafine particle ICS, antileukotrienes, and combination therapies.
- Smoking, not asthma itself, is primarily responsible for poor prognosis, including increased risks of lung cancer, cardiovascular diseases, and mortality.
Conclusions:
- Smoking asthma presents significant diagnostic and management challenges for clinicians.
- Further research is essential to thoroughly evaluate and address these challenges.
